WebIn this experiment, you will test several optical aspects of electromagnetic waves such as polarization, reflection, and interference. The electromagnetic spectrum covers a wide range of frequencies. Visible light has a frequency of the order of 10 14 Hz and wavelengths between 400 and 700 nm (1 nm = 10 −9 m).
